Delphi - Asignar a vector usando variable como indicador de

 
Vista:

Asignar a vector usando variable como indicador de

Publicado por christian (41 intervenciones) el 13/09/2003 17:39:37
¿Se puede?
Estoy tratando de hacer esto:

private
{ Private declarations }
contador:byte;
numeros:array[1..10] of integer;
public
{ Public declarations }
end;

var
Form1: TForm1;

implementation

{$R *.dfm}

procedure TForm1.Button1Click(Sender: TObject);
begin
if contador < high(numeros) + 1 then
begin
numeros[contador]:=strtoint(edit1.Text);
{aqui contador toma el valor del edit1}
contador:=contador + 1;
end
else
showmessage('No hay mas lugar');
end;

Y me encuentro que contador termina cargandose con
el valor que estoy tratando de asignarle al vector
numeros en la posicion que marca el contenido de
la variable contador.
Desde ya muchas gracias por cualquier respuesta u orientacion
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Asignar a vector usando variable como indicador

Publicado por Diego Romero (636 intervenciones) el 16/09/2003 09:05:01
¿No modificas en alguna otra parte la variable contador?, realmente es muy extraño lo que te sucede.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ar